Subject: Cut-over done — build agent clock skew fixed

Hey Priya,

Quick wrap-up on yesterday's cut-over. The Tallowmere build agents were drifting up to 40 seconds apart, which is why signed artifacts kept failing verification. We moved all agents off the old local NTP box onto the Hollis time service and added a skew check to the pipeline preflight. No failures since. For your review, the agents now run with the following settings.

settings of yahaf-tahop:
jorox:
  pin: 5851
  tenant: noveth
  seal: seal_7ddb5c42
  metrics_host: metrics.jorox.ordinnet.example
  standby_team: wenax
  escalation: oliath-feneth
  nonce: 552548

## Locker Assignment — Night Shift

Night-shift staff at the Kestrel Point depot are assigned lockers in the west changing room only. Locker numbers are issued by the shift supervisor at the start of your first rotation; do not use an unassigned locker, as day-shift allocations overlap. Report broken locks to Facilities via the wall phone. The changing room is keypad-controlled outside core hours, and the current door code is listed below.

door code, kawip-bagap: bdg-HQEWH-4

- [ ] Step 7: Archive cold storage buckets (Glacierline tier). Confirm both ceremony witnesses are present, verify bucket manifests match the Oxbow ledger, then seal the archive key shares. Plugin authors may observe but not handle shares. Once sealed, the archive index itself is encrypted and can only be reopened with the passphrase below.

vault phrase of badup-hahig = tamael-aldael-kelmir-istael-fenok-istwyn-tamius-jorath-oliion

## Changelog — Ticktrace 1.9

### Renamed: DRIFT_API_TOKEN
During the cron drift investigation we found plugins confusing this variable with the metrics token, so it has been renamed to indicate it authorizes drift-report uploads specifically. Plugin authors must read the new name from 1.9 onward; the old name is ignored without warning. Sample env files in the SDK are updated. In your deployment env file, the drift-report upload secret is set on the next line.

env line for fawef-taguf: VAULT_KEY13=a9695905a9a90